 Effective October 1, 2023, USDA loans in Kentucky has announced updates regarding the following topics. • Fiscal Year 2024 Conditional Commitment USDA announced a delay of approximately two weeks in allocation of funding; however, we will continue to close, fund, and purchase of Kentucky USDA loans , even those with conditional commitments issued as “subject to the availability of commitment authority.” • Changes to eligibility of certain rural areas o USDA announced new ineligible area maps will be updated on the Guarantee Underwriting System (GUS) and USDA Income and Property Eligibility site on October 1, 2023. New Kentucky USDA Rural Housing  Income limits for most counties in 2023 (*) in Kentucky are $110,600 for a household family of four and household families of five or more  can make up to $146,050 w ith the new changes for  2023 Kentucky USDA Income limits , the Jefferson County Louisville, KY Metro area (**) saw an increase of  $110,600 for a family of four and up to $146,050 for a family of five or more. The metro area surrounding counties of Jefferson County includes Oldham, Bullitt, Spencer are included in these higher income limits for USDA loans. Kentucky Rural Housing USDA Guideline Updates for 2023

  As a reminder, annual income differs from repayment income. Annual income for the household will be used to calculate the adjusted annual household income to determine eligibility for a USDA-guaranteed loan. The main purpose of the following revisions in paragraph 9.3 is to ensure that lenders are aware that they are to calculate and properly document all adult household members’ income for annual income eligibility purposes…not just parties to the loan note. It’s important to be aware of income sources that are counted and NOT counted as well as how to properly determine both “annual” and “repayment” income. I recommend that you thoroughly read Chapter 9 and refer to Attachment 9-A and Attachment 9-D in HB-1-3555 to review income and asset types, guidance for annual and repayment purposes, and documentation options acceptable to verify the income or asset source.
